Bacon Sandwiches and Salvation: An A to Z of the Christian Life. Another classic from Adrian Plass. Gently pokes fun at the quirks and foibles of us "Crazy Christians", with our often unintelligible Christianese. Never distasteful or inappropriately irreverent, however - Adrian's books always have tremendous heart beneath the wry wit and wonderful British humour.
